Idaho S 1285 (2018) — BANKING Repeals, amends and adds to existing law to revise provisions regarding credit unions.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2018-02-09 Introduced; read first time; referred to JR for Printing introduction
  • 2018-02-12 Reported Printed; referred to Commerce & Human Resources
  • 2018-02-23 Reported out of Committee with Do Pass Recommendation; Filed for second reading committee-passage-favorable
  • 2018-02-26 Read second time; filed for Third Reading
  • 2018-02-27 Read third time in full PASSED - 35-0-0AYES Agenbroad, Anthon, Bair, Bayer, Brackett, Buckner-Webb, Burgoyne, Crabtree, Den Hartog, Foreman, Guthrie, Hagedorn, Harris, Heider, Hill, Johnson, Jordan, Keough, Lakey, Lee, Lodge, Martin, Mortimer, Nonini, Nye, Patrick, Potts, Rice, Siddoway, Souza, Stennett, Thayn, Vick, Ward-Engelking, WinderNAYS NoneAbsent and excused NoneFloor Sponsor - PatrickTitle apvd - to House reading-3, passage
  • 2018-02-28 Received from the Senate, Filed for First Reading
  • 2018-02-28 Read First Time, Referred to Business
  • 2018-03-08 Reported out of Committee with Do Pass Recommendation, Filed for Second Reading committee-passage-favorable
  • 2018-03-09 Read second time; Filed for Third Reading
  • 2018-03-12 Read Third Time in Full PASSED - 64-0-6AYES Amador, Anderson, Bell, Blanksma, Boyle, Burtenshaw, Chaney, Cheatham, Chew, Clow, Collins, Crane, Dayley, DeMordaunt, Dixon, Ehardt, Erpelding, Gannon(17), Gannon(5), Gestrin, Giddings, Hanks, Harris, Hartgen, Holtzclaw, Horman(Reed), Kauffman, Kerby, King, Kingsley, Kloc(Tway), Loertscher, Luker, Malek, Manwaring, McCrostie, McDonald, Mendive, Miller, Moon, Moyle, Nate, Packer, Palmer, Perry, Raybould, Redman, Rubel, Scott, Shepherd, Smith, Stevenson, Syme, Thompson, Toone, VanOrden, Vander Woude, Wagoner, Wintrow, Wood, Youngblood, Zito, Zollinger, Mr. SpeakerNAYS NoneAbsent Anderst, Armstrong, Barbieri, Gibbs, Monks, TroyFloor Sponsor - CraneTitle apvd - to Senate reading-3, passage
  • 2018-03-13 Returned From House Passed; referred to enrolling
  • 2018-03-14 Reported enrolled; signed by President; to House for signature of Speaker
  • 2018-03-14 Received from Senate; Signed by Speaker; Returned to Senate
  • 2018-03-15 Reported signed by the Speaker & ordered delivered to Governor
  • 2018-03-15 Reported delivered to Governor at 11:35 a.m. on 03/15/18
  • 2018-03-20 Signed by Governor on 03/20/18 Session Law Chapter 165 Effective: 07/01/2018 executive-signature
